    spinner bait is a confidence bait (like a jig) that work in every situation and any lake in the nation ...... altho so time better than others! I've can truly say some form of spinner bait has accounted for at less 60% of the bass I've caught since 1978.
    my advise is experiment blade size and type. keep it simple. find a weight that you can fish in your area of lakes. colors that work then utilize different size blades to make it effective the conditions you have that day.(clear the water the smaller and faster you want the bait to travel } my all round weight starts out as 1/2. most Yadkin lakes double willow gold and chrome blades. muddy water change from willow to Indiana and muddier go with Colorado the size will be predicted by the clarity & temperature of water and the depth you need to have the bait run " above" you bass. another tip is you will have 50% more strikes when you use a trailer. there again experiment on how the trailer effect the bait and what the fish want that day. alright ..there yall go any more and I will have to shoot all of yall
